Q Is it, is it in that case because they have insufficient supply of gas to feed those, those projects, or is it that gas prices are too high and so they'd be losing money on producing more?
A It's gas prices too high. Uh, when you look at the economics of it, it just doesn't make sense with where global nitrogen values are. And I also think there's the political aspect of it, right? The European political engine has been really charging towards green energy and Frankly, this old school, old technology nitrogen production, from their viewpoint, is very dirty. It's outdated. We don't want to have anything to do with it. So you've already got bad economics for the plan, and then you've got a political outlook that basically sits there and says, don't put any money in these plans because you're probably not long for this world. We're not going to support it. We're doing everything we can to shut you down.

Q Okay, so how much of, I mean, I don't know, give me a sense of the magnitude of the shock that has created. How much of global supply then is just, has, you know, vanished while the Strait of Hormuz is closed?
A With that body of water closed, just in itself, I think we're talking about a third of the world's tradable urea, gone. And a good chunk of the global anhydrous, I mean, the same thing. These same plants that produce urea also produce a tremendous amount of anhydrous. But that's not even the worst part of it, right? Then all of a sudden you got to think about, well, what else comes out of that body of water? You've got LNG shipments that are stuck behind there, and that feeds major manufacturers like India. I mean, to give you a scale of it, Europe, we're talking about, you know, their 75% production rate, that's three and a half million tons missing. India is very reliant on those LNG exports from the Persian Gulf. That's how they feed their nitrogen plants. And just to give you a scope of size, they produce over thirty million tons of urea every single year. And at one point at their worst spot, their production rates were down to 50 or 60% of normal because of high prices, because of the lack of the input. So that's on an annualized basis, that's fifteen million tons per year that was missing. That's the equivalent of all of Europe. So that's where this thing is just completely blown out, right? It's, it's no longer just the individual products. Now we're talking about the inputs and for phosphate, it's the lack of sulfur and the lack of anhydrous and the high price of those…

A The best thing to show as far as talk about that's actually living proof of it is India. Now, India is a little bit of a different beast. A lot of the world farmers have to ebb and flow their demand based on what prices are because their price is a direct correlation reflection of what the world market is. Indian farmers, they don't care what's going on around the world. Their price stays low and steady, and that's dictated by the government, and what the government does is they subsidize the price difference between that farmer and And the rest of the world. So their demand doesn't move because they just don't care. They paid one of the highest prices we've seen in a very, very long time here recently to buy two and a half million tons. Over 900 dollars a ton. I think the West Coast prices were 935 dollars a ton. East Coast prices were nine 50 plus. An incredibly high price, but they were still able to find the product. Q So just to clarify, historically, China was the number one phosphate exporter, the number two urea exporter, and then they basically stopped exports. And as of now, they've stated they're going to start exports again this summer, but TBD if that actually happened. So that's thing one that was already contributing to global supply tightness. Then there's Europe and the Ukraine-Russia situation. What impact did that have?
A This goes all the way back to 2021, and during that time, that is when you saw Europe basically sit there and tell Russia, we're not interested in any flows from your Nordstrom II pipeline that you just spent all this money building. And they got into a TIF, and eventually Russia shut off the flows, and then somebody, I still don't think we actually know who did it, plenty of theories, but we don't know, actually blew up the pipelines under the water. Well, from Russia's standpoint, why would I go repair them? Europe doesn't want the gas. I'm not going to go spend the time and the money and the effort to repair those pipelines. European gas values skyrocketed, right? That Dutch GTF went from whatever the normal was, three, four, five dollars in MMBTU to, I think it was August, 20, 21, a 103 dollars in MMBTU. Now, since then, we've normalized the market, and they're finally back to, like, 1015 is kind of their normal range, but that means their production, their nitrogen production in Europe is only sitting about 75% of normal, and that's for all of Europe, and when you start to break that down, That's about three and a half million tons of urea that's not being produced a year. That's a couple million tons of uan not being produced a year. And that hurts. Q That's, uh, that's how I understand it to be. Let's do it. Start with what's been going on over the past 10 weeks since the U.S. invaded Iran. Like, what's happening in the fertilizer market at the high level?
A We, as a market, have experienced a supply tightness that we've never seen in the history of our markets. Now, we've had periods where supplies have gotten snug. We've seen situations where prices have gotten high. But nothing ever to this extent. And it's all surrounding the Strait of Hormuz, or so the market likes to think. The problem is, if you go back to January one, nitrogen markets and phosphate markets were already dealing with supply tightness because of European production rates, because of a lack of Chinese exports, because the ongoing Russian-Ukraine war. The Strait of Hormuz was just that shot of adrenaline that nobody really needed. So it's just, it's a period that we've never seen in this marketplace. We've always theorized, but it's always one of those tongue-in-cheek like, Who in the world would ever think the straight Hormuz was going to shut down for 1011 weeks? But here we are, and we're just trying to get through it, and trying to kind of transition from the spring season to the summer season, and figure out, how's all this going to play out?

Q things then, setting aside the global picture, um, does that dire scenario where the Strait of Hormuz remains closed for some number of additional months Are we going to see big impacts in North America, or is it that we're actually pretty insulated? And, you know, most of the rest of the world is going to feel the, besides, I guess, China as well, is going to feel the pain.
A Let's assume that the government is not going to come in and start restricting markets. And what I mean by that is mostly from an export standpoint. If there's no restriction to exports, if the rest of the world's dealing with a situation like phosphate supplies are incredibly hard to find, same thing with urea. People cannot find it, and the price just starts to tick higher and higher and higher. Well, if our price doesn't do anything, well, that export opportunity pops up, an arbitrage opportunity pops up, and we start losing supply that we can't lose. And so that's why you see our market go with the rest of the world, and people do get a little upset when they're sitting there saying, we produce most of this. Why Why is it the Henry Hub is dirt cheap, but my nitrogen price is sky high like the rest of the world? That shouldn't be the case.

Q How long can it sit on that ship?
A It's going to depend on the conditions of the ship and loading and things like that, and the quality of when it was produced. So, I mean, if it's good quality coming out of the facility, presume it's a well, let's say a tight ship, right? You don't have a bunch of leaks. You don't have humidity getting into the holds. It can last for a while, but the problem is the true nature of it is humidity is a big thing. I mean, you're sailing across the ocean. You're surrounded by water. That water, that humidity seeps its way into it, and that degrades the quality of it. It starts to go down. It starts to kind of break it apart. So I don't know. There's too many variables there, but I would say you're probably talking, you're not talking years. You're probably talking months.
